DRILLING MUDS FLOW REGIMES & RHEOLOGY MODELS

Flow Regimes are the behavior of the fluid while flowing in a well. The most common regimes are laminar, turbulent, and transitional. Unfortunately, it is impossible to define each type in the well clearly.
